Otis is a gorgeous gray-and-white 5-month-old male tabby with the softest fur and the sweetest heart. He’s a shy little guy at first and will need a bit of patience as he gets to know you…But once he does, he truly blossoms!
When Otis feels safe, he becomes incredibly affectionate. He loves attention, cuddles, and being close to his person. One of his favorite games is playing fetch with a fuzzy mouse toy- He’ll happily chase it, bring it back, and do it all over again! He has plenty of kitten energy and absolutely loves to play. Otis would do especially well in a home with another cat close to his age.
Otis would thrive with someone who understands that shy kittens often grow into the most devoted companions. If you’re willing to give him a little time, he’ll reward you with endless affection, playful antics, and a deep bond that makes every bit of patience worthwhile.
Otis is ready to find the loving home he’s been waiting for. Could it be yours?
*Our cats are looking for indoor only homes.* All Paws Rescue cats have been spayed or neutered, microchipped, tested for FELV/FIV, received flea/tick prevention, been dewormed, and are up to date on all age-appropriate vaccinations. We do not have an actual facility as all of our animals live in foster homes in our community. We schedule meet and greets with approved applicants usually at your home, pet stores or parks. We do not transport, deliver, or charge any fees to meet the animal. Adoption fees are only collected once the animal is adopted.

All Paws Rescue is a foster-based, 501(c)(3) animal welfare organization. We're committed to improving the lives of homeless companion animals by providing temporary homes until they can be adopted into loving families, and by spreading awareness and sharing resources to limit pet overpopulation.
